The Craft of Iranian Floor Coverings: Exploring Weaves, Quality and Worth

Considering into the captivating realm of Persian floor coverings reveals a intricate craft. Their magnificent creations are far more than simply decorative; they represent generations of skill passed down through dynasties. An defining characteristic is often the knot density—a measurement reflecting the number of knots for square inch. Higher knot counts generally signify increased detail, finer workmanship and, therefore, enhanced price. Factors influencing value also include the sort of wool or silk utilized, the coloring methods – plant-based dyes are particularly valued – and the intricacy of the pattern.

  • Construction Density: Determines fineness
  • Components: Material type and dye
  • Design: Meaning and creative merit
